2

PTC Creo Generative Design

Native AI-Driven Topology Optimization

The quintessential built-in co-pilot that turns functional requirements into complex, production-ready geometries.

Flawless integration as a native ai solution for ptc creoRapidly produces lightweight, structurally sound iterationsDirectly accounts for specific manufacturing constraints like casting or 3D printingRequires deep pre-existing knowledge of the Creo CAD ecosystemComputationally heavy for extremely intricate assemblies
3

Ansys Discovery

Real-Time AI Physics Simulation

An interactive crystal ball for predicting structural and thermal performance on the fly.

Provides immediate visual feedback on design changesPairs exceptionally well with traditional creo cad with ai workflowsDrastically reduces reliance on traditional, slow-solve simulationsHigh initial licensing cost for enterprise deploymentRequires dedicated GPU hardware for optimal real-time performance
4

nTop

Advanced Implicit Modeling

The architect's dream for designing unbreakable, lightweight lattices for aerospace.

Unparalleled capability in generating complex lattice structuresRobust algorithmic control over geometric parametersSeamlessly exports data to modern 3D printing slicing enginesSteep learning curve due to non-traditional implicit modeling paradigmExporting back to standard CAD formats can sometimes lose parameter history
5

Altair Inspire

Simulation-Driven Design Exploration

A pragmatic, highly accessible simulation tool that democratizes topology optimization.

Highly intuitive interface accessible to non-CAE expertsExcellent motion analysis and dynamic loading simulationsAccelerates the shift from design to manufacturing validationLess granular control over meshing compared to flagship solversMay struggle with incredibly dense, multi-physics simulations
6

Autodesk Fusion 360

Cloud-Native CAD/CAM Integration

The Swiss Army knife of modern cloud manufacturing and generative design.

Excellent built-in generative design extensions via cloud computingComprehensive CAM toolpaths available right out of the boxHighly collaborative environment for distributed engineering teamsCloud dependency can be a bottleneck for secure, offline defense projectsGenerative design studies require continuous cloud credit consumption
7

Siemens NX

Enterprise-Grade Digital Twin Platform

The heavyweight champion for orchestrating the entire lifecycle of a commercial airliner.

Industry-leading handling of massive assembliesSophisticated AI-powered command predictions and UI adaptationsComprehensive digital twin integration across the manufacturing floorOverwhelming interface for newer engineers or small-scale tasksImplementation and maintenance demand significant IT infrastructure
